An older patient has been brought into the emergency department with injuries caused by suspected physical abuse. Which tools could the nurse use to assess this patient's injuries? Standard Text: Select all that apply.
 
  1. Indicators of abuse screen
  2. AMA assessment protocol
  3. Adult protective services report
  4. Brief abuse screen for the elderly
  5. Hwalek-Sengstock elder abuse screening test

Answer to Question 1

1,2,4,5
Rationale: The indicators of abuse screen is a 29-item set of indicators for use by social service agency practitioners to identify elder mistreatment.
